使用 Aspose.HTML for Java 将 EPUB 转换为 BMP

介绍

在数字时代,内容转换和转换是各种应用程序的必要任务。如果您希望使用 Java 将 EPUB 文件转换为 BMP 格式,那么您来对地方了。Aspose.HTML for Java 为这项任务提供了强大而高效的解决方案。在本分步指南中,我们将引导您完成将 EPUB 文件转换为 BMP 格式的过程。您不需要成为专家即可遵循这些步骤,但您应该对 Java 编程有基本的了解。

先决条件

在开始使用 Aspose.HTML for Java 将 EPUB 转换为 BMP 之前,请确保已满足以下先决条件:

  1. Java 开发环境:确保您的系统上已设置 Java 开发环境。您可以从以下位置下载并安装最新版本的 Java:Oracle 网站.

  2. Aspose.HTML for Java:您需要安装 Aspose.HTML for Java 库。您可以从Aspose.HTML for Java 下载页面.

  3. EPUB 文件:有一个要转换为 BMP 的 EPUB 文件。您可以使用任何 EPUB 文件,也可以下载示例 EPUB 文件进行测试。

导入包

为了启动转换过程,您需要从 Aspose.HTML for Java 导入必要的包。这些包对于处理 EPUB 到 BMP 的转换至关重要。以下是所需的导入:

import com.aspose.html.converters.Converter;
import com.aspose.html.saving.ImageSaveOptions;
import com.aspose.html.rendering.image.ImageFormat;
import java.io.FileInputStream;

现在,让我们将 EPUB 到 BMP 的转换过程分解为多个步骤。

打开 EPUB 文件

要开始转换过程,请打开现有的 EPUB 文件进行阅读。您可以使用java.io.FileInputStream类来实现这一点。以下是打开 EPUB 文件的代码:

try (FileInputStream fileInputStream = new FileInputStream("input.epub")) {
    //您的后续步骤代码将放在此处
}

初始化 ImageSaveOptions

接下来,初始化ImageSaveOptions对象来配置 BMP 格式转换的参数。此步骤对于设置输出 BMP 文件的格式至关重要。您可以按照以下步骤操作:

ImageSaveOptions options = new ImageSaveOptions(ImageFormat.Bmp);

EPUB 转换为 BMP

现在,是时候将 EPUB 文件转换为 BMP 了。您可以使用Converter.convertEPUB方法来实现这一点。以下是转换的代码:

Converter.convertEPUB(
    fileInputStream,
    options,
    "output.bmp"  //指定输出 BMP 文件名
);

就这样!您已成功使用 Aspose.HTML for Java 将 EPUB 文件转换为 BMP 格式。

总之,这三个步骤概述了使用 Aspose.HTML for Java 将 EPUB 文件转换为 BMP 的整个过程。确保您具有所需的先决条件并导入了必要的包,然后按照以下步骤完成转换。无论您是想将电子书、文档还是任何其他 EPUB 格式的内容转换为 BMP,本指南都会为您简化此过程。

结论

在处理数字内容时,将 EPUB 转换为 BMP 格式是一项宝贵的技能。Aspose.HTML for Java 为这项任务提供了一种高效而直接的解决方案。通过遵循本文概述的分步指南,您可以轻松执行 EPUB 到 BMP 的转换并将其集成到您的项目中。

常见问题

Aspose.HTML for Java 是一个免费库吗?

不,Aspose.HTML for Java 不是免费的。您可以从以下网站获取许可证或临时许可证,以满足您的开发需求Aspose 网站或者临时执照页面.

我可以使用 Aspose.HTML for Java 将其他格式转换为 BMP 吗?

Aspose.HTML for Java 主要专注于 HTML 和 EPUB 转换。不过,您可以探索其他 Aspose 库来转换各种格式。

使用 Aspose.HTML for Java 进行 BMP 转换过程有什么限制吗?

Aspose.HTML for Java 提供可靠的 BMP 转换流程。但是,性能和输出质量可能因 EPUB 文件的复杂性而有所不同。

如何获得 Aspose.HTML for Java 的支持?

如果您遇到任何问题或需要帮助,您可以访问Aspose 支持论坛寻求帮助。

Aspose.HTML for Java 支持转换哪些其他格式?

Aspose.HTML for Java 支持多种格式,包括 PDF、XPS 和许多图像格式。您可以浏览文档这里了解更多详情。